#4929ba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4929ba is composed of 28.6% red, 16.1%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.8% cyan, 78%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 253.2 degrees, a saturation of 63.9% and a lightness of 44.5%. #4929ba color hex could be obtained by blending #9252ff with #000075.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#4929ba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4929ba has RGB values of R:73, G:41, B:186 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0.78,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 4794810.

Hex triplet 4929ba #4929ba
RGB Decimal 73, 41, 186 rgb(73,41,186)
RGB Percent 28.6, 16.1, 72.9 rgb(28.6%,16.1%,72.9%)
CMYK 61, 78, 0, 27
HSL 253.2°, 63.9, 44.5 hsl(253.2,63.9%,44.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 253.2°, 78, 72.9
Web Safe 3333cc #3333cc
CIE-LAB 30.753, 52.082, -70.608
XYZ 12.402, 6.547, 47.062
xyY 0.188, 0.099, 6.547
CIE-LCH 30.753, 87.738, 306.413
CIE-LUV 30.753, -0.329, -93.678
Hunter-Lab 25.587, 41.739, -91.139
Binary 01001001, 00101001, 10111010

Shades and Tints of #4929ba

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040209 is the darkest color, while #f9f8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#4929ba

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#706f74 is the less saturated color, while #3506dd is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#4929ba is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#434343 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#443e5b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#004f9a Protanopia 1% of men
  • #005486 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#005960 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#1a41a6 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#1a4499 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#1a4880 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
